Originally Posted by 69Firebird400
I prefer a CD slot mount - I literally have never put a CD into my slot in six months. It doesn't block airflow from the vents, doesn't block the view out the windshield, doesn't get in the path of the moving MMI screen (on an iPhone 6 4.7") and is close at hand for using Waze while driving.

Here's the one I have: Amazon.com: Mountek nGroove Universal CD Slot Mount for Cell Phones and GPS Devices: MP3 Players & Accessories

I have been using ProClip mounts for awhile on all my cars. This has been great... Very secure, not very visible from the outside and once removed it leaves no trace.

I really would love having Waze on the MMI.
